Freshaman Dons vs. Ventura, March 26th
The Freshman Dons picked up another Channel League victory Friday night, heading into spring break with a solid 6-3 win over Ventura. Tanner Guerra started on the mound and pitched well, allowing just one run in 5 innings. The Dons scored first when Johnny Brontsema drew a lead-off walk and the next 5 batters put the ball in play. Ventura threatened to score in the 2nd, but a great play at the plate by Beau Parker and Toby Minehan kept the lead. Ventura tied it up in the 3rd off a single and a double. In the bottom of the 4th Tanner Guerra hit a solo home run to take back the lead. Errors by Ventura allowed Toby Minehan and Pete Ghersen to reach base, and Toby stole home to make the score 3-1 after 4 innings. Ventura threatened again in the 5th, but great defensive playpicking off base runners kept them from scoring. In the bottom of the 6th, Johnny Brontsema was hit by a pitch and then Zach Torres and Jason Jimenez walked to load the bases, then all scored on RBI singles by Michael Day and Miles Waters to make the score 6-1. Ventura threatened again in the top of the 7th and scored two more runs, but solid defensive play shut them down to hold on for the win.
